Proper polyphony for multiple seaboard blocks.

 I just got a second and third seaboard block, and have been very excited to have a 72-note mini-seaboard.


But when I hooked them together I had all sorts of problems.  After some reading on the topic, I learned that each seaboard needs to have it's own range of midi channels.  That is frustrating, as it limits the polyphony of each block to 5.


True polyphony for multiple seaboard blocks would be a big plus for me.  It's what I expected when I bought them.

It's not just extra effort to set the fixed channels up for several instruments to acommodate their respective channel count. It's a mayor hassle, for sure, but the main issue I have with this is the reduced voice count per block, because there is no way around it, whatever the effort.


The most extreme example I've come across was when I visited a friend who has a hardware synth (the name of which I forgot) that can listen and play 4 channels of MIDI. It was very nice playing it with a single Block, but we would have liked a broader note range. Connecting a second block reduced each block to 2 voices, it just didn't make sense to do that.

It turns out that the recommended workaround - assign dedicated channel ranges for each connected Seaboard/Lightpad Block - is not compatible with ROLI Studio Player. RSP will forcefully overwrite the settings done in Dashboard and replace them with a version that results in the dreaded channel overlap issue between devices to raise its ugly head again - this time with no possible workaround in sight.

Effectively, playing multiple Seaboard Blocks (as well as Lightpads in Note grid mode) is currently not supported in RSP!
